A varied programme of early 18th Century music performed by local artists
This concert on the date of Chippendale’s baptism and in the church where the ceremony took place will feature Joanne Dexter (soprano), cellist Mark Webb and the Chippendale Singers amongst others.
A bar will be available. Complimentary tercentenary christening cake will be supplied by Patisserie Viennoise and offered during the interval.
